<p>Ajka Crystal, also known as Ajka Kristály of Hungary, has been crafting fine lead crystal since 1878. The factory is famous for richly colored overlays—ruby, cobalt, emerald, amber, and amethyst—cut back to sparkling clear designs. Pieces from the late twentieth century were often exported to upscale shops worldwide, and many were produced in small batches by master cutters. Collectors prize the weight, ring, and precision of the patterns, which reflect old‑world skills. This line of brandy snifters shows why Ajka is sought after: it’s decorative on a shelf, but built to be used. Hand wash only, always avoid dishwashers and sudden temperature swings.</p>

<p>Ajka Crystal is made in Hungary and is respected for mouth-blown, hand-cut lead crystal in particularly deep jewel tones—blue, ruby, emerald, and amethyst—often produced as cut-to-clear like this example. Artisans lay a thin colored layer over clear crystal, then wheel-cut patterns to reveal flashes of clear beneath. Typical Ajka glass carries about 24% lead oxide for extra sparkle and that satisfying resonance. The 1980s were a strong export period internationally, so many pieces were sold through department stores and gift shops, sometimes with an Ajka Hungary sticker. Collectors watch for even cutting, smooth rims, and a consistent overlay. Hand wash; avoid dishwashers and temperature shocks to preserve brilliance.</p>

<p>Ajka Crystal comes from the Hungarian town of Ajka, where the glassworks began in 1878 and built a reputation for richly colored, mouth‑blown, hand‑cut lead crystal. Their cut‑to‑clear technique uses a colored outer layer over clear crystal, then artisans wheel‑cut patterns to expose the brilliance underneath. Classic colors include emerald, cobalt, ruby, and amethyst, and many pieces were exported to top department stores and luxury retailers. Most Ajka pieces meet full‑lead standards for that signature sparkle and ring. Because each one is finished by hand, slight variations are normal and prized by collectors, especially in the bold green seen here.</p>

<p>Bohemian crystal comes from centuries of glassmaking in the Czech Republic, renowned since the 13th century and celebrated for clarity and hand-cut designs. Ruby cut to clear is made by casing a thin ruby layer over clear crystal, then wheel-cutting through the color to draw patterns; the technique gives vivid contrast and sparkle. The Hobstar and pinwheel motifs trace to the Brilliant Period and were embraced by Czech cutters well into the 20th century. Around 1970, workshops in Czechoslovakia produced expertly finished export pieces like this, each unique. For care, hand wash, dry and avoid sudden temperature changes.</p>

<p>Cut‑to‑clear crystal is made by layering colored glass over clear, then wheel‑cutting patterns through the color to expose sparkling facets. European houses in Bohemia, Hungary, Slovenia, and Belgium popularized the look, and many 1970s–1980s pieces used 24% lead crystal for extra brilliance and weight. Bud vases from these lines were often offered in amber, ruby, cobalt, and emerald, sold through department stores and gifted for weddings and anniversaries. Hallmarks include crisp edges, a polished rim, and a ground foot. Care is simple: wash by hand, avoid the dishwasher, and keep the label intact. Seed bubbles and shelf wear are normal.</p>

<p>Bohemian crystal has been made for centuries in the Czech lands, where glassmakers perfected high‑lead recipes that cut easily and sparkle. Pieces like this are often cut to clear, meaning a colored layer is laid over clear crystal and then carved back to form the pattern. Mid‑century workshops in Czechoslovakia exported widely, and many carried a gold foil label reading Bohemia Glass or Made in Czechoslovakia rather than an etched mark. The thistle motif is a classic, prized for sharp detail and nod to resilience. Expect a bright ring when tapped, crisp wheel cuts, and a polished base.</p>
